Krauss-Maffei Extrusion

 

Complete solutions for continuous production of foam insulated pipe

 

Krauss Maffei Extrusion of Munich Germany, a world leader in plastics machinery, has successfully created a complete system for the continuous production of PU insulated pipes, which can integrate different plastic processes.

 

Pipe made of PE-HD, PE-X, PE-RT or PB is produced on a conventional pipe extrusion line, where a barrier layer can also be applied. The standard version of the production system can be used to produce pipe with an outer diameter between 20 and 110mm. The continuous production process involves the pipe coming off the line, which is then wound onto large steel drums ready for transfer to the second production system unit for the application of the insulation layer.

Advantages of the new foam insulated pipe system include:-

  • A PU mixing head that produces an insulation layer with a very low thermal conductivity – between 0.02 and 0.03 W/m*K, which makes highly efficient insulated pipes, ideal for when a significant temperature differential must be maintained between the medium flowing through the pipes and the ambient temperature. Such as supply lines for geothermal plants, hot water pipes and air-conditioning.

  • The relatively high level of automation that results in lower labour costs.

  • No length limits on the pipes being produced, which is possible due to the PU mixing head, which eliminates stoppages for cleaning and changing the mixing head

  • Faster and easier laying of pipes, as there are minimal risks of thermal bridges and leaks. This is the result of the longer lengths and the number of connections required.
